This is a Request for Quotation (RFQ) for crane, operator, and rigging support for the demobilization of diving operations aboard NOAA ship Oscar Elton Sette. The required services include lifting a 19,000 lbs dive chamber and transporting it. Quotes must be submitted electronically via email to ***@***. *. * no later than May 27, 2026, **** EDT. Evaluation will be based on price and technical acceptability, past performance, access to military installation, availability, and delivery timeline. Payment terms are net 30.
The required deliverable schedule is on 04 September 2026 via timeline listed above.
The government intends to award a low priced, technically acceptable, single firm fixed price purchase order on an all basis with payment terms of net 30.
Evaluation will be based on the following: 1. technical acceptability capability. vendors approach to complete the job. 2. past performance 3. access to military installation, availability, and delivery timeline. 4. price firm fixed.
Offerors must have an active registration in the system for award management sam found at https:sam. gov content home to provide a quote and be eligible for award.
A site visit is highly recommended but not required. please contact ***@***. *. * to set up a time to visit the site.
Failure to provide all information to aid in the evaluation may be considered non responsive. offers that are non responsive may be excluded from further evaluation and rejected without further notification to the offeror.

The City of Lubbock is seeking bids for maintenance and repair services for heavy-duty, off-road, watercraft, and specialty vehicles and equipment. Bids can be submitted electronically via Bonfire or in hard copy. The deadline for submission is August 11, 2026, at 3:00 PM. The contract will be for one year with four one-year renewal options. Vendors must be familiar with all requirements and specifications. The city reserves the right to award to multiple vendors. Estimates for repairs up to $1,000 can be verbally approved, $1,****,500 require written approval, and over $2,500 need approval from the Director of Fleet Services. All services require a city-issued work order number. Repairs are warranted for 12 months. Bidders must provide at least five commercial customer references. Emergency first responders will be given priority service.
Sealed bids or electronic submittals must be received by August 11, 2026, prior to 3:00 PM. Allow time for uploading required documentation, with 24 hours in advance recommended.
Invoices must be submitted within 5 business days of service completion via email PDF to ***@***. *. * will be made in accordance with the city's standard payment terms and procedures. The city may also use its Mastercard purchasing card.
All repairs shall be warranted for a period of 12 months. The vendor will be responsible for correcting all previous repairs performed by the vendor that were incorrectly repaired or failed to correct the reported deficiency.
The contract may be awarded to the lowest responsible bidder or to the bidder who provides goods or services at the best value for the City of Lubbock, considering price, reputation, quality, needs, past relationship, impact on HUBs, and total long-term cost.
Bidders may be required to show they have the necessary facilities, ability, and financial resources to provide the service satisfactorily. A minimum of five commercial customer references from the past 24 months is required.
The city may charge a fee of **** per vehicle per day for late delivery. Default in any manner under the contract may authorize the purchasing director to purchase goods elsewhere and charge any increase in cost and handling to the defaulting seller.
All protests regarding the ITB process must be submitted in writing to the City Director of Purchasing and Contract Management within 5 working days after the protesting party knows of the occurrence of the action which is protested.
Failure to manually sign the bid, submitting conditional alternate bids, showing omissions or alterations, or failing to comply with listed general conditions may result in disqualification.
